Output 50217f5625296746a4906f0893c4378da043843f880bfbbc6d7a9deda9c6259d:1

value
37952806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b17586a061210ddddd59e03a30500b293a610f8a OP_EQUAL
address
3HsLKLdsZQZwbMJ2dEjfs6kk3sg7o3Ujnm
transaction
50217f5625296746a4906f0893c4378da043843f880bfbbc6d7a9deda9c6259d
spent
true